Konfiguration und Verwaltung der Metadatenfunktionalität in Assets config-metadata

Version
Artikel-Link
AEM as a Cloud Service
Hier klicken
AEM 6.5
Dieser Artikel

Adobe Experience Manager Assets speichert Metadaten für jedes Asset. Damit können Assets einfacher kategorisiert und organisiert und bestimmte Assets leichter von Benutzern gefunden werden. Da Sie Metadaten mit den Assets speichern und verwalten können, können Sie Assets basierend auf ihren Metadaten automatisch organisieren und verarbeiten. Adobe Experience Manager Assets ermöglicht es Admins, die Metadatenfunktionalität zu konfigurieren und anzupassen, um das standardmäßige Adobe-Angebot zu ändern.

Bearbeiten eines Metadatenschemas metadata-schema

Weitere Informationen finden Sie unter Bearbeiten von Metadatenschema-Formularen.

Registrieren eines benutzerdefinierten Namespace in Experience Manager registering-a-custom-namespace-within-aem

Sie können eigene Namespaces in Experience Manager hinzufügen. Es gibt vordefinierte Namespaces wie cq, jcr und sling. Sie können aber auch einen Namespace für Ihre Repository-Metadaten und die XML-Verarbeitung hinzufügen.

  1. Zugriff auf die Knotentyp-Administrationsseite https://[aem_server]:[port]/crx/explorer/nodetypes/index.jsp.
  2. Um auf die Seite zur Namespace-Verwaltung zuzugreifen, klicken Sie oben auf der Seite auf Namespaces.
  3. Um einen Namespace hinzuzufügen, klicken Sie unten auf der Seite auf Neu.
  4. Geben Sie einen benutzerdefinierten Namespace gemäß der XML-Namespace-Konvention an. Geben Sie die ID in Form eines URI und verknüpftes Präfix für ID an. Klicken Sie auf Speichern.

Konfigurieren des Grenzwerts für die Metadaten-Massenaktualisierung bulk-metadata-update-limit

Um DoS (Denial of Service)-ähnliche Situationen zu vermeiden, beschränkt Enterprise Manager die Anzahl der Parameter, die in einer Sling-Anforderung unterstützt werden. Wenn Sie die Metadaten vieler Assets auf einmal aktualisieren, erreichen Sie möglicherweise das Limit, sodass die Metadaten für weitere Assets nicht aktualisiert werden können. Enterprise Manager generiert die folgende Warnung in den Protokollen:

org.apache.sling.engine.impl.parameters.Util Too many name/value pairs, stopped processing after 10000 entries

Um das Limit zu ändern, gehen Sie zu Tools > Vorgänge > Web-Konsole und ändern Sie den Wert der Max. POST-Parameter in der OSGi-Konfiguration für das Parameter-Handling von Apache Sling-Anfragen.

Metadatenprofile metadata-profiles

Mit einem Metadatenprofil können Sie Standardmetadaten auf Assets in einem Ordner anwenden. Erstellen Sie ein Metadatenprofil und wenden Sie es auf einen Ordner an. Jedes Asset, das Sie später in den Ordner hochladen, erbt die standardmäßigen Metadaten, die Sie in „Metadatenprofil“ konfiguriert haben.

Hinzufügen eines Metadatenprofils adding-a-metadata-profile

  1. Gehen Sie zu Tools > Assets > Metadatenprofile und klicken Sie dann auf Erstellen.

  2. Geben Sie einen Titel für das Profil ein, z. B. Sample Metadata, und klicken Sie auf Erstellen. Es wird Formular bearbeiten für das Metadatenprofil angezeigt.

    Bearbeiten eines Metadaten-Formulars

  3. Klicken Sie auf eine Komponente und konfigurieren Sie ihre Eigenschaften auf der Registerkarte Einstellungen. Klicken Sie beispielsweise auf die Beschreibungskomponente und bearbeiten Sie die Eigenschaften.

    Festlegen einer Komponente im Metadatenprofil

    Bearbeiten Sie die folgenden Eigenschaften für die Komponente Beschreibung:

    • Feldbezeichnung: Der Anzeigename der Metadateneigenschaft. Dieser dient lediglich als Referenz für den Benutzer.

    • Zu Eigenschaft zuordnen: Der Wert dieser Eigenschaft liefert den relativen Pfad oder Namen zum Asset-Knoten für dessen Speicherort im Repository. Der Wert sollte immer mit ./ beginnen, weil dies anzeigt, dass sich der Pfad unter dem Knoten des Assets befindet.

    Einstellung von „Zu Eigenschaft zuordnen“ im Metadatenprofil

    Der Wert, den Sie für Zu Eigenschaft zuordnen angeben, wird als Eigenschaft unter dem Metadatenknoten des Assets gespeichert. Wenn sie z. B. ./jcr:content/metadata/dc:desc als Namen von Zu Eigenschaft zuordnen angeben, speichert Assets den Wert dc:desc im Metadatenknoten des Assets. Es wird empfohlen, einer bestimmten Eigenschaft im Metadatenschema nur ein Feld zuzuordnen. Andernfalls wird das der Eigenschaft zuletzt zugeordnete Feld vom System ausgewählt.

    • Standardwert: Mit dieser Eigenschaft können Sie einen Standardwert für die Metadatenkomponente hinzufügen. Wenn Sie beispielsweise „Meine Beschreibung“ angeben, wird dieser Wert der Eigenschaft dc:desc im Metadatenknoten des Assets zugewiesen.

    Festlegen einer Standardbeschreibung im Metadatenprofil

    note note
    NOTE
    Wenn Sie einer neuen Metadateneigenschaft (die noch nicht im Knoten /jcr:content/metadata vorhanden ist) einen Standardwert hinzufügen, werden die Eigenschaft und deren Wert nicht standardmäßig auf der Seite Eigenschaften des Assets angezeigt. Um die neue Eigenschaft auf der Seite Eigenschaften des Assets anzuzeigen, müssen Sie das entsprechende Schemaformular ändern.
  4. (Optional) Fügen Sie auf der Registerkarte Formular erstellen weitere Komponenten zu Formular bearbeiten hinzu, und konfigurieren Sie deren Eigenschaften auf der Registerkarte Einstellungen. Folgende Eigenschaften sind auf der Registerkarte Formular erstellen verfügbar:

Komponente
Eigenschaften
Bereichs-Kopfzeile
Feldbezeichnung,
-Beschreibung
Einzeiliger Text
Feldbezeichnung,
Zu Eigenschaft zuordnen,
Standardwert
Mehrfachwerttext
Feldbezeichnung,
Zu Eigenschaft zuordnen,
Standardwert
Zahl
Feldbezeichnung,
Zu Eigenschaft zuordnen,
Standardwert
Datum
Feldbezeichnung,
Zu Eigenschaft zuordnen,
Standardwert
Standard-Tags
Feldbezeichnung,
Zu Eigenschaft zuordnen,
Standardwert,
Beschreibung
  1. Klicken Sie auf Fertig. Das Metadatenprofil wird zur Liste der Profile auf der Seite Metadatenprofile hinzugefügt.

    Auf der Seite „Metadatenprofile“ hinzugefügtes Metadatenprofil

Kopieren eines Metadatenprofils copying-a-metadata-profile

  1. Wählen Sie auf der Seite Metadatenprofile ein Metadatenprofil aus, um eine Kopie davon zu erstellen.

    Kopieren eines Metadatenprofils

  2. Klicken Sie in der Symbolleiste auf Kopieren.

  3. Geben Sie im Dialogfeld Metadatenprofil kopieren einen Titel für die neue Kopie des Metadatenprofils ein.

  4. Klicken Sie auf Kopieren. Die Kopie des Metadatenprofils wird in der Liste mit Profilen auf der Seite Metadatenprofile angezeigt.

    Eine Kopie des auf der Seite „Metadatenprofile“ hinzugefügten Metadatenprofils

Löschen eines Metadatenprofils deleting-a-metadata-profile

  1. Wählen Sie auf der Seite Metadatenprofile das zu löschende Profil aus.

  2. Klicken Sie in der Symbolleiste auf  Metadatenprofile löschen.

  3. Klicken Sie im Dialogfeld auf Löschen, um den Löschvorgang zu bestätigen. Das Metadatenprofil wird aus der Liste gelöscht.

Metadatenschema für einen Ordner folder-metadata-schema

Mit Adobe Experience Manager Assets können Sie Metadatenschemata für Asset-Ordner erstellen, die die auf Seiten mit Ordnereigenschaften angezeigten Layouts und Metadaten definieren.

Hinzufügen von Ordner-Metadatenschema-Formularen add-a-folder-metadata-schema-form

Verwenden Sie den Editor für Metadatenschema-Formulare, um Metadatenschemata für Ordner zu erstellen und zu bearbeiten.

  1. Gehen Sie in der Experience Manager-Benutzeroberfläche zu Tools > Assets > Ordner-Metadatenschemata.
  2. Klicken Sie auf der Seite Ordner-Metadaten-Schemaformulare auf Erstellen.
  3. Geben Sie einen Namen für das Formular an und klicken Sie auf Erstellen. Das neue Schemaformular wird auf der Seite Schemaformulare aufgeführt.

Bearbeiten von Ordner-Metadatenschema-Formularen edit-folder-metadata-schema-forms

Sie können ein neu hinzugefügtes oder vorhandenes Metadatenschema-Formular bearbeiten, das Folgendes enthält:

  • Registerkarten
  • Formularelemente innerhalb von Registerkarten.

Sie können diese Formularelemente einem Feld innerhalb eines Metdatenknotens im CRX-Repository zuordnen bzw. dafür konfigurieren. Sie können dem Metadatenschema-Formular neue Registerkarten oder Formularelemente hinzufügen.

  1. Wählen Sie auf der Seite „Schemaformulare“ das erstellte Formular aus und klicken Sie in der Symbolleiste auf die Option Bearbeiten.

  2. Klicken Sie auf der Seite „Ordner-Metadatenschema-Editor“ auf +, um eine Registerkarte zum Formular hinzuzufügen. Um die Registerkarte umzubenennen, klicken Sie auf den Standardnamen und geben Sie unter Einstellungen den neuen Namen an.

    custom_tab

    Um weitere Registerkarten hinzuzufügen, klicken Sie auf +. Klicken Sie zum Löschen in einer Registerkarte auf X.

  3. Fügen Sie in der aktiven Registerkarte eine oder mehrere Komponenten von der Registerkarte Formular erstellen hinzu.

    adding_components

    Wenn Sie mehrere Registerkarten erstellen, klicken Sie auf eine bestimmte Registerkarte, um Komponenten hinzuzufügen.

  4. Um eine Komponente zu konfigurieren, wählen Sie diese aus und ändern Sie ihre Eigenschaften auf der Registerkarte Einstellungen.

    Löschen Sie ggf. eine Komponente über die Registerkarte Einstellungen.

    configure_properties

  5. Um die Änderungen zu speichern, klicken Sie in der Symbolleiste auf Speichern.

Komponenten zum Erstellen von Formularen components-to-build-forms

Die Registerkarte Formular erstellen enthält Formularelemente, die Sie im Ordner-Metadatenschema-Formular verwenden. Die Registerkarte Einstellungen enthält die Attribute für jedes Element, das Sie auf der Registerkarte Formular erstellen auswählen. Im Folgenden finden Sie eine Liste der auf der Registerkarte Formular erstellen verfügbaren Elemente:

Komponentenname
Beschreibung
Bereichs-Kopfzeile
Fügen Sie eine Abschnittsüberschrift für eine Liste allgemeiner Komponenten hinzu.
Einzeilentext
Fügen Sie eine einzeilige Texteigenschaft hinzu. Diese wird als Zeichenfolge gespeichert.
Mehrfachwerttext
Fügen Sie eine Texteigenschaft mit mehreren Werten hinzu. Diese wird als Zeichenfolgen-Array gespeichert.
Zahl
Fügen Sie eine Zahlenkomponente hinzu.
Datum
Fügen Sie eine Datumskomponente hinzu.
Dropdown
Fügen Sie eine Dropdown-Liste hinzu.
Standard-Tags
Fügen Sie ein Tag hinzu.
Ausgeblendetes Feld
Fügen Sie ein ausgeblendetes Feld hinzu. Dieses wird beim Speichern des Assets als POST-Parameter gesendet.

Bearbeiten von Formularelementen editing-form-items

Um die Eigenschaften von Formularelementen zu bearbeiten, klicken Sie auf die Komponente und bearbeiten Sie folgende Eigenschaften auf der Registerkarte Einstellungen.

Feldbezeichnung: Der Name der Metadateneigenschaft, der auf der Eigenschaftenseite des Assets angezeigt wird.

Zu Eigenschaft zuordnen: Diese Eigenschaft gibt den relativen Pfad des Ordnerknotens im CRX-Repository an, wo das Element gespeichert ist. Sie beginnt mit „./“, was angibt, dass sich der Pfad unter dem Knoten des Ordners befindet.

Im Folgenden finden Sie die gültigen Werte für diese Eigenschaft:

  • ./jcr:content/metadata/dc:title: Speichert den Wert im Metadatenknoten des Ordners als Eigenschaft dc:title.

  • ./jcr:created: Zeigt die Eigenschaft „JCR“ im Knoten des Ordners an. Wenn Sie diese Eigenschaften in CRXDE konfigurieren, empfiehlt Adobe, dass Sie sie mit „Bearbeitung deaktivieren“ markieren, da sie geschützt sind. Andernfalls tritt der Fehler Asset(s) failed to modify auf, wenn Sie die Eigenschaften des Assets speichern.

Um zu gewährleisten, dass die Komponente ordnungsgemäß im Metadatenschema-Formular angezeigt wird, fügen Sie dem Eigenschaftenpfad keine Leerzeichen hinzu.

JSON-Pfad: Verwenden Sie diese Eigenschaft, um den Pfad der JSON-Datei anzugeben, in der Sie Schlüssel-Wert-Paare für Optionen speichern.

Platzhalter: Verwenden Sie diese Eigenschaft, um relevanten Platzhaltertext für die Metadateneigenschaft anzugeben.

Wahlen: Mit dieser Eigenschaft legen Sie Optionen in einer Liste fest.

Beschreibung: Mit dieser Eigenschaft können Sie eine kurze Beschreibung für die Metadatenkomponente hinzufügen.

Klasse: Objektklasse, mit der die Eigenschaft verknüpft ist.

Löschen von Ordner-Metadatenschema-Formularen delete-folder-metadata-schema-forms

Sie können Ordner-Metadatenschema-Formulare über die Seite „Ordner-Metadatenschema-Formulare“ löschen. Um ein Formular zu löschen, wählen Sie es aus und klicken Sie in der Symbolleiste auf die Option „Löschen“.

delete_form

Zuweisen eines Ordner-Metadatenschemas assign-a-folder-metadata-schema

Sie können ein Ordner-Metadatenschema über die Seite „Ordner-Metadatenschema-Formulare“ oder bei der Ordnererstellung einem Ordner zuordnen.

Wenn Sie ein Metadatenschema für einen Ordner konfigurieren, wird der Pfad in der Eigenschaft folderMetadataSchema des Ordnerknotens unter ./jcr:content gespeichert.

Zuweisen eines Schemas über die Seite „Ordner-Metadatenschema“ assign-to-a-schema-from-the-folder-metadata-schema-page

  1. Gehen Sie in der Experience Manager-Benutzeroberfläche zu Tools > Assets > Ordner-Metadatenschemata.

  2. Wählen Sie auf der Seite „Ordner-Metadatenschema-Formulare“ das Schemaformular aus, das Sie auf einen Ordner anwenden möchten.

  3. Klicken Sie in der Symbolleiste auf Auf Ordner anwenden.

  4. Wählen Sie den Ordner aus, auf den Sie das Schema anwenden möchten, und klicken Sie auf Anwenden. Wenn bereits ein Metadatenschema auf den Ordner angewendet wurde, wird eine Warnung dazu angezeigt, dass das bestehende Schema überschrieben wird. Klicken Sie auf Überschreiben.

  5. Öffnen Sie die Metadateneigenschaften für den Ordner, auf den Sie das Schema angewendet haben.

    Ordnereigenschaften

    Um die Felder der Ordnermetadaten anzuzeigen, klicken Sie auf die Registerkarte Ordnermetadaten.

    folder_metadata_properties

Zuweisen eines Schemas bei der Ordnererstellung assign-a-schema-when-creating-a-folder

Sie können beim Erstellen eines Ordners ein Ordner-Metadatenschema zuweisen. Wenn mindestens ein Ordner-Metadatenschema im System vorhanden ist, wird eine zusätzliche Liste im Dialogfeld Ordner erstellen angezeigt. Sie können das gewünschte Schema auswählen. Standardmäßig ist kein Schema ausgewählt.

  1. Klicken Sie in der Symbolleiste der Experience Manager Assets-Benutzeroberfläche auf Erstellen.

  2. Geben Sie einen Titel und eine Beschreibung für den Ordner an.

  3. Wählen Sie in der Liste „Ordner-Metadatenschema“ das gewünschte Schema aus. Klicken Sie dann auf Erstellen.

    select_schema

  4. Öffnen Sie die Metadateneigenschaften für den Ordner, auf den Sie das Schema angewendet haben.

  5. Um die Felder der Ordnermetadaten anzuzeigen, klicken Sie auf die Registerkarte Ordnermetadaten.

Verwenden des Ordner-Metadatenschemas use-the-folder-metadata-schema

Öffnen Sie die Eigenschaften für einen Ordner, der mit einem Ordner-Metadatenschema konfiguriert wurde. Hierdurch wird die Registerkarte Ordnermetadaten auf der Seite mit den Eigenschaften des Ordners angezeigt. Um das Ordner-Metadatenschema-Formular anzuzeigen, wählen Sie diese Registerkarte aus.

Geben Sie Metadatenwerte in die verschiedenen Felder ein und klicken Sie auf Speichern, um die Werte zu speichern. Die angegebenen Werte werden im Ordnerknoten im CRX-Repository gespeichert.

folder_metadata_properties-1

Tipps und Einschränkungen best-practices-limitations

  • Um Metadaten in benutzerdefinierte Namespaces zu importieren, registrieren Sie zunächst die Namespaces.
  • Die Eigenschaftenauswahl zeigt Eigenschaften an, die in Schema-Editoren und Suchformularen verwendet werden. Die Eigenschaftenauswahl wählt keine Metadateneigenschaften aus einem Asset aus.
  • Möglicherweise sind bereits vorhandene Metadatenprofile vorhanden, bevor Sie ein Upgrade auf Experience Manager 6.5 durchführen. Wenn Sie nach dem Upgrade ein solches Profil in den Ordner-Eigenschaften in der Registerkarte Metadatenprofile anwenden, werden die Metadatenformularfelder nicht angezeigt. Wenn Sie jedoch ein neu erstelltes Metadatenprofil anwenden, werden die Formularfelder angezeigt, sind aber wie erwartet nicht verfügbar. Es gibt keinen Funktionsverlust. Wenn Sie jedoch die (nicht verfügbaren) Formularfelder anzeigen möchten, bearbeiten und speichern Sie die vorhandenen Metadatenprofile.
recommendation-more-help
19ffd973-7af2-44d0-84b5-d547b0dffee2